Carmen Ejoko stars in new Netflix thriller Rattlesnake, and a new trailer gives us our first look at her in action.
Announced last year, the film is written and directed by Zak Hilditch, who also helmed Netflix original film 1922. It follows a single mother (Ejogo), who accepts the help of a mysterious woman after her daughter (Apollonia Pratt) is bitten by a rattlesnake.
But she finds herself forced to pay back her “debt” by doing he unthinkable: taking the life of a total stranger in the rural town of Tulia, Texas. Ejogo is joined on screen by Theo Rossi and Emma Greenwell, while Halditch is joined behind the camera by producer Ross Dinerstein, a fellow 1922 veteran.
The film premieres on Netflix on 25th October. Here’s the trailer:

Carmen Ejogo will star in Rattlesnake, a new psychological thriller from Netflix.
The film follows a single mother who accepts the help of a mysterious woman after her daughter is bitten by a rattlesnake, but finds herself forced to pay back her “debt” by taking the life of a total stranger in the rural town of Tulia, Texas.
Ejogo, who has impressed in Selma, Roman J. Israel, Esq. and Fantastic Beasts, and will soon be seen in True Detective Season 3, leads a cast that includes Theo Rossi (Sons of Anarchy, Luke Cazge, Lowriders), and Emma Greenwell (Shameless, Love & Friendship, The Rock).
The project marks something of a reunion for production company Campfire and Netflix. Founded in 2014 by Ross Dinerstein, its recent films include the Netflix Originals Rebirth, Clinical, 1992, 6 Balloons and The Package. Dinerstein will produce Rattlesnake too. Competing the reunion is 1992 helmer Zak Hilditch, who writes and directs the thriller.
Production on Rattlesnake began this week.
